"Spring in the City" is an enchanting oil painting that captures the essence of a tranquil spring landscape juxtaposed against the bustling cityscape. The artist skillfully brings together elements of nature and urbanity, creating a captivating scene that evokes a sense of serenity and solitude. The foreground of the painting is dominated by a magnificent lone tree, adorned with lush green leaves and vibrant blossoms. Standing tall and proud, the tree symbolizes resilience and beauty amidst the surrounding urban environment. Its branches gracefully spread out, creating an intricate pattern against the canvas. In the distance, the city emerges, its architectural structures outlined against the horizon. The artist's attention to detail is evident as the skyline showcases a variety of buildings, each with its unique silhouette. However, despite the presence of human habitation, the city appears dormant and devoid of activity. Not a single light flickers in the windows, suggesting that the inhabitants are all peacefully asleep, undisturbed by the outside world. The sky above is painted in various shades of blue, capturing the essence of a late evening in spring. It exudes a sense of calm and tranquility, with wisps of clouds adding depth and dimension to the scene. The artist's brushstrokes skillfully blend the colors, creating a harmonious interplay between the vibrant blues of the sky and the earthy browns of the landscape. The overall color palette predominantly consists of blue and brown tones, with subtle hints of green and white. This choice of colors reinforces the theme of the painting, emphasizing the contrasting elements of nature and urban life. The blue hues convey a sense of tranquility and peace, while the earthy browns ground the composition, reminding viewers of the underlying connection to the physical world. "Spring in the City" is a captivating work of art that invites viewers to pause and reflect on the juxtaposition of nature and the urban environment. It celebrates the beauty of the natural world, even in the midst of a bustling city, and encourages contemplation on the serenity that can be found when everything is still, and the world around us slumbers. About the artist: Alex Kalenyuk was born in March 13, 1954, in the city of Piryatin, Poltava region, Ukraine. He graduated from the Crimean Art College named after N. Samokish (1887). Teachers in the specialty V. Grigoriev, M. Morgun, and L. Gracer had enduring influence on Mr. Kalenyuk's paintings. The artist's main genres are landscape and still life. The paintings are distinguished by emotional openness, warmth, and affirm the harmony of life. Dominants of creativity are the deep roots of national traditions, Ukrainian cultural heritage. Alex Kalenyuk is a member of the National Union of Artists of Ukraine since 2008. He taught fine art at the Pyryatinsky school - gymnasium of aesthetic education from 1988 to 2008. Mr. Kalenyuk came to national prominence as a fine artist in 1978 and has had numerous national and international exhibitions since then: Kiev (2003, 2007-2009), Lubny (Poltava region), California (USA; 2006), Poltava (2007, 2010), Priluki (Chernihiv region, 2008), Warsaw (2009). Works that received high acclaim among art critics and collectors are "Flowers field "(2007),"Still life with a daffodil "(2004), "Indian summer "(2007)," " Kalina red "(2004)", "Evening Breath" (2005), "Summer" (2006), "Sunflowers" (2007), "In the Garden" (2009), "It's Cold"(2010). Currently Alex Kalenyuk's paintings are given prominence in the National Museum of Art, National U. T.
